A cherrywood sideboard with a marble top and leaded glass, in Art Nouveau style (Viennese Secession), dating to 1910–1920, by J. & J. Kohn, Austria, with dimensions 227 cm high, 125 cm wide, 57 cm deep.
Description from the seller
This impressive solid cherry wood piece dating back to the early 1900s features a contemporary label from the historic Austro-Hungarian company Jacob & Josef Kohn.
Founded in 1849, J. & J. Kohn was a pioneer in the production of bentwood furniture and, at the beginning of the 20th century, collaborated intensively with leading designers of the Wiener Werkstätte such as Hoffmann, Gustav Siegel, and Otto Wagner, transforming industrially produced furniture into fine examples of designer furniture.
The warm color of cherry wood contrasts with the elegant marble top. The doors are decorated with finely crafted stained glass, attributed to the historic Moser glassworks.
Below, there is a convenient additional wooden shelf, probably designed as a desk. All the internal compartments of the drawers are original, and the furniture is supplied with the original keys for the upper and lower doors.
The sideboard is in excellent condition, with two missing elements that are easily restorable: one of the wooden sides framing the marble top (right side); a central shelf and the middle internal shelf at the bottom (lost during moves).
Measures
Height: 227 cm
Width: 125 cm
Depth: 57 cm
Purchased at the Finarte Auction House in the historic headquarters of Via Manzoni in Milan, the current owner does not possess the original identification documents, which were lost over time.
